dc.description.abstract | The DevOps paradigm means that development and operations for an organisation blend together. For security, this implies that information on detected attacks can be fed back to the development, enabling faster eradication of vulnerabilities in software. This is particularly important in cloud installations, where release cycles can be less than a day. This paper argues that DevOps can be employed for overall improved software security | nb_NO |
